Global Expansion Opportunities LIFT Aircraft's recent demonstration at World Expo 2025 in Osaka and expansion into the Japanese market through a partnership with Marubeni Aerospace indicate a strong interest in international markets for personal eVTOL experiences. This presents opportunities to develop sales strategies targeting not only entertainment venues but also government and corporate clients across Asia.

Military & Government Potential The company's recent contract with the U.S Army Applications Laboratory to develop medical and casualty evacuation payloads highlights a growing avenue for sales in defense, emergency response, and Government sectors seeking innovative unmanned vertical flight solutions.

Commercial Experience Expansion With the successful launch of pay-per-flight and customer flight experiences, LIFT Aircraft is positioned to increase revenue streams through customizable personal flight services. Sales efforts can focus on recreational, corporate, and educational markets eager for accessible flight experiences.

Partnership & Collaboration Leverage Partnerships such as with the United States Air Force and Marubeni Aerospace demonstrate a strong interest in collaborative development and technology validation. These relationships open doors for commercial licensing, co-development, and B2B sales targeting other military, aerospace, and commercial operators.

Technology & Product Development Regular upgrades to the HEXA aircraft since 2021 show an active focus on refining safety, reliability, and capacity. Sales targets include sectors requiring customized or advanced eVTOL solutions, including emergency medical services, corporate transport, and specialized industrial applications.

WE BELIEVE IN A FUTURE WHERE EVERYONE CAN FLY...   and that future is starting right now. You may not believe it yet - but you will. Personal flight is one of humanity's most enduring aspirations, but has historically only been available to a privileged few with the money, time, and skill to fly traditional aircraft. We're making the joy and utility of personal, vertical flight accessible to everyone.
